Title:The Relationship Between Training and Small Firm Performance; Research Frameworks and Lost Quests
Journal:International small business journal
2000 : OCT-DEC, VOL. 19:1, p. 11-27

Abstract:The primary focus of this discussion is to establish a framework that might allow more informed comment on the relationship between training and performance. This paper contributes to this debate firstly by considering existing literature specifically pertaining to the issue of training small firm performance and secondly by critically evaluating the methodological approaches which have been utilised by such studies. This will lead into a debate research design and the development of a framework in which the relationship of training and performance can be considered. Finally, it will be argued that the manner in which the 'training process' is currently considered is too narrow.
